Rowland, Missouri
Rowland is an unincorporated community in Cedar County, in the U.S. state of Missouri.[1]
History
A post office called Rowland was established in 1898, and remained in operation until 1906.[2] The community has the name of R. P. Rowland, the original owner of the town site.[3]
